Trend 1: Personalized Beauty
The demand for personalized beauty solutions is on the rise. Consumers now expect products tailored to their unique skin types, preferences, and needs. This trend has sparked a surge in bespoke skincare formulations and customizable makeup options, allowing individuals to achieve a truly personalized beauty regimen.
Trend 2: Holistic Beauty and Wellness
The concept of beauty is evolving to encompass overall well-being. There is a growing focus on holistic beauty, which integrates skincare, nutrition, mental health, and fitness. Consumers are seeking products and routines that promote not just outer beauty but also inner health and balance.
Trend 3: Social Media Influence
Social media continues to be a powerful force in the beauty industry. Platforms like Instagram, TikTok, and YouTube are not just places for product promotion but are also driving trends, educating consumers, and shaping beauty standards. Influencers and beauty enthusiasts play a crucial role in this dynamic ecosystem, guiding consumer choices and preferences.
Challenges: Ethical Ingredient Sourcing
While the move towards ethical ingredient sourcing is commendable, it presents significant challenges. Ensuring that ingredients are sourced responsibly and ethically can be a complex task. This involves not only verifying the sustainability of the raw materials but also ensuring fair labor practices and supporting local communities.
Challenges: Regulatory Compliance
Navigating the myriad of regulations in different markets is another pressing challenge. From ingredient restrictions to labeling requirements, staying compliant with diverse regulatory standards can be daunting. This requires continuous monitoring and adaptation to ensure that products meet the highest standards of safety and efficacy.
